How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Englewood?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Englewood Studio Apartments | $1,585 | $795 | $2,469 |
| Englewood 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,692 | $895 | $3,688 |
| Englewood 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,283 | $1,145 | $7,229 |
| Englewood 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,049 | $1,336 | $10,000+ |
| Englewood 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,736 | $2,150 | $3,740 |

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
